WTB: [QLD] - BA Layshaft
As the title states im looking for a 28 Spline BA Layshaft, and a 28 Spline BA Passenger side Gearbox Cup.
Doing LSD Conversion in KF TX3 so just after these items and ill be good to go now, hehe |

im not 100% sure, ive done a bit of reading up on the fl.com forum and found that i need the 28 spline layshaft from a BA G series, then i need to shave 5mm off the diff end and respline the other end to 26 spline.
